Overview:
The UF Health Sleep Center provides diagnosis and treatment for a variety of sleep disorders under the direction of a multidisciplinary team of University of Florida College of Medicine board-certified sleep medicine physicians. The center interacts with a variety of physicians, including adult and pediatric pulmonologists, neurologists, dentists, surgeons and sleep psychologists to diagnose and treat sleep disorders in adults and children. The 12-bed Sleep Disorders Center, located at Magnolia Parke, operates seven nights per week and features state-of-the-art monitoring equipment.The Polysomnographic Technologist performs polysomnograms overnight. Administers oxygen and nasal continuous positive airway pressure and employs ventilatory assist devices in accordance with established protocols. Recognizes at risk events and notifies appropriate physicians.Responsibilities:Status: PRNFTE: .40Shift Hours: VARIABLEDays of Week: VARIABLEQualifications:Minimum Education and Experience Requirements:High School graduate or equivalent.Degree is preferred but not required.Registered Polysomnographic Technologist certification (RPSGT) from the BRPT or the AASMs Registered Sleep Technologist certification (RST) is required.Will consider board eligible graduate of an accredited Polysomnography program. The applicant MUST pass board examination within 3 months of employment.Current CPR required prior to first day of clinical work.Motor Vehicle Operator Designation: Employees in this position: Will not operate vehicles for an assigned business purpose
Licensure/Certification/Registration: RPSGT OR RST
